7.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

2 mins • 1 pt

Media Image

A student sets up a circuit which she calls circuit 1. She records the value of the current I1, and calculates the resistance R1 of the circuit. She then connects an identical resistor in parallel with the original resistor. She calls this circuit 2. She records current I2 and calculates the total resistance R2 of this circuit. Which row correctly compares the two currents and the two resistances in the circuits?

A) I2 is greater than I1 and R2 is greater than R1.

B) I2 is greater than I1 and R2 is less than R1.

C) I2 is less than I1 and R2 is greater than R1.

D) I2 is less than I1 and R2 is less than R1.
